Indianapolis and Depok present fundamentally different profiles for potential residents and investors in 2026. Indianapolis, located in the United States, benefits from a significantly higher GDP per capita ($60,000 vs. $13,900) and lower unemployment rates, reflecting a robust and diversified economy. This economic strength translates into higher average salaries, with Indianapolis residents earning about $6,000 more per month on average compared to Depok residents. Consequently, the cost of living in Indianapolis, particularly for housing and transportation, is substantially higher, with a monthly rent cost approximately 10 times greater than in Depok. The quality of life in Indianapolis, measured by indices like healthcare, safety, and climate, is considerably better, with nearly all key quality metrics being in the 'excellent' or 'good' range compared to Depok's generally lower scores. Depok, situated in Indonesia, offers a vastly more affordable lifestyle, with rent being the most significant cost saver. However, this comes at the expense of quality metrics, where Depok scores considerably lower than Indianapolis across healthcare, safety, climate, and pollution levels. The economic disparity between the two cities is stark, with Indianapolis boasting a much higher standard of living and quality of life, albeit at a significantly higher financial cost, while Depok provides a much lower cost of living but with considerably lower quality metrics and economic indicators.
